Manufacturer Highlights

The Goodman® brand GCVC Series Gas Furnace offers energy efficiencies and operating sound levels that are among the best in the heating and cooling industry. Quality manufacturing as well as easy installation and maintenance make this unit one of the best values on the market.

Standard Features

  • ComfortNet™ Communicating System compatible
  • Heavy-duty aluminized-steel tubular heat exchanger
  • Stainless-steel secondary heat exchanger
  • Two-stage gas valve provides quiet, economical heating
  • Durable Silicon Nitride igniter
  • Quiet two-speed induced draft blower
  • Utilizes ComfortNet™ communicating, two-stage or single-stage thermostats
  • Self-diagnostic control board with constant memory fault code history output to a dual 7-segment display
  • Color-coded low-voltage terminals with provisions for electronic air cleaner and humidifier
  • Efficient and quiet variable-speed airflow system gently ramps up or down according to heating or cooling demand
  • Multiple continuous fan speed options offer quiet air circulation
  • Auto-Comfort and enhanced dehumidification modes available
  • All models comply with California Low Nox emissions standards

Cabinet Features

  • Designed for multi-position installation - downflow, horizontal left or right
  • Certified for direct vent (2-pipe) or non-direct vent (1-pipe)
  • Easy-to-install top venting with optional side venting
  • Convenient left or right connection for gas and electrical service
  • Cabinet air leakage (QLeak) - 2%
  • Heavy-gauge steel cabinet with durable finish
  • Fully insulated heat exchanger and blower section
  • Airtight solid bottom or side return with easy-cut tabs for effortless removal in bottom air-inlet applications

Specifications

Model GCVC960603BN
UPC 663051469303
AHRI Number 7368838
Gas Furnace Efficiency 96+%
Air Flow Direction Downflow, Horizontal
Configuration Floor Mounted
Avg Coverage Area 1,000 - 1,200 Sq Ft
Blower Motor Variable Speed
Cooling Compatibility (up to) 3 Ton
Electrical Phase 1-Phase
Exhaust Pipe PVC
Fuel Source Natural Gas
Gas Valve Two Stage
Max Overcurrent Protection 15 amps
Primary Heating Capacity 55,001 - 60,000 BTU
Product Height (in) 34.5
Product Length (in) 28.75
Product Width (in) 17.5
System Application Type Central Split Systems
Vent Connection 3 inches, 4 inches
Voltage 120
Warranty 10 Year Parts, Lifetime Heat Exchanger, 10 Year Unit Replacement
Weight (lbs) 119.0000
